Pl/sqL

Fermé
DevGl Messages postés 136 Date d'inscription samedi 23 novembre 2013 Statut Membre Dernière intervention 16 mai 2015 - 10 janv. 2015 à 00:09
DevGl Messages postés 136 Date d'inscription samedi 23 novembre 2013 Statut Membre Dernière intervention 16 mai 2015 - 11 janv. 2015 à 15:17
Bonjour , je suis débutant en PL/SQL , et veux executer ce petit code , mais il me donne une erreur .

voila le code:

define employee_number = 124;
DECLARE
emp_rec emp%ROWTYPE;
BEGIN
SELECT * INTO emp_rec
FROM emp
WHERE empno = &employee_number;
INSERT INTO retired_emps(empno, ename, job)

VALUES (emp_rec.empno, emp_rec.ename, emp_rec.job) ;

COMMIT;
END;
/
erreur est : Line NumberUnknown Statement1DEFINE employee_number = 124

c'est quoi le probléme??

3 réponses

f894009 Messages postés 17185 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 15 avril 2024 1 702
10 janv. 2015 à 08:40
0
DevGl Messages postés 136 Date d'inscription samedi 23 novembre 2013 Statut Membre Dernière intervention 16 mai 2015
10 janv. 2015 à 14:00
Merci F894009 , Mais j'ai pas trouvé une réponse à ma question :( !
0
f894009 Messages postés 17185 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 15 avril 2024 1 702
10 janv. 2015 à 17:03
Re,

a voir comme ceci

DECLARE
employee_number = 124;
emp_rec emp%ROWTYPE;
0
DevGl Messages postés 136 Date d'inscription samedi 23 novembre 2013 Statut Membre Dernière intervention 16 mai 2015
11 janv. 2015 à 14:15
Ah non , ca marche pas :/
0
f894009 Messages postés 17185 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 15 avril 2024 1 702
11 janv. 2015 à 14:23
Re,

Desole, ai plus pl/sql
0
DevGl Messages postés 136 Date d'inscription samedi 23 novembre 2013 Statut Membre Dernière intervention 16 mai 2015
11 janv. 2015 à 15:17
ok , merci en tout cas
0